1980 Volkswagen T2 Camper
Fantastic example of the Devon Moonraker

Built late in 1979 and first registered January 1980 believed to be one of the last Moonrakers produced. Finished in white over orange and retaining many of its original features. The vendor advises the pop top material is original along with 1 set of cushions (a newer white vinyl trimmed set is fitted with an original set also included) as well as period correct drive away awning.

Fitted with a reconditioned 1600cc engine during the current keepers 12 year ownership. Showing 28,000 miles although previous MOT certificates show it to be 128,000 due to a 5 digit speedo.

Sold with a large collection of previous MOT certificates as well as records of servicing and maintenance and 2 keys and alarm fobs.
